referring to fig. 1 and 3, a plurality of long positioning holes 21 are horizontally formed in the top plate 2, the long positioning holes 21 are located right above the cutting grooves 11, two short through holes 314 are formed in the two sides of the positioning plate 31 at the same horizontal position of the long positioning holes 21, and the positions of the long positioning holes 21 and the cutting grooves 11 are distributed according to different sizes of canvas to be cut.
Referring to fig. 1 and fig. 3, the locking rod 4 is inserted into the two short through holes 314 and any one of the long positioning holes 21, the end of the locking rod 4 is fixedly connected with the screw rod 42, the screw rod 42 is connected with the locking nut 43 through a thread, one end of the locking rod 4 far away from the locking nut 43 is fixedly connected with the cross cap 41, the side wall of the positioning plate 31 is provided with a cross-shaped insertion opening 315, and the cross cap 41 is inserted into the cross-shaped insertion opening 315.
Referring to fig. 4, four threaded holes 312 are formed at four corners of the bottom surface of the slider 36, four threaded through holes 311 are formed at four corners of the cutting plate 37, the threaded through holes 311 and the threaded holes 312 are in threaded connection with the fixing bolts 38, an insertion opening 313 is formed in the bottom surface of the cutting plate 37, which is located outside the threaded through holes 311, and the nut of the fixing bolt 38 is inserted into the insertion opening 313.
Referring to fig. 3, a screw rod 318 is horizontally rotatably connected in the sliding slot 35, a threaded sleeve 319 is fixedly connected in the slider 36, the screw rod 318 is engaged with the threaded sleeve 319, one end of the cutting board 34 is fixedly connected with a motor bin 320, a small motor 321 is fixedly connected in the motor bin 320, the end of the screw rod 318 is fixedly connected at the rotating shaft of the small motor 321, two telescopic main rods 316 are fixedly connected to the bottom surfaces of the two sides of the positioning board 31 respectively, the bottom of each telescopic main rod 316 is slidably sleeved with a telescopic slave rod 317, and the bottom end of each telescopic slave rod 317 is fixedly connected to the top surface of the cutting board 34.
Referring to fig. 1 and 5, a plurality of limiting side plates 14 are fixedly connected to two sides of the top surface of the cutting platform 1 between the cutting grooves 11, the end of the cutting platform 1 is vertically and fixedly connected to the abutting plate 13, two releasing notches 15 are formed in two sides of the abutting plate 13 at the edge of the top surface of the cutting platform 1, before the cutting platform works, it is determined at which long positioning hole 21 the cutting assembly 3 should be fixed according to the length to be cut of the canvas, the canvas is fixed by the locking rod 4 after the determination, the end of the canvas is pulled to the abutting plate 13, the canvas is flatly laid at the releasing notches 15 at the positions of the hands, the side edge of the canvas contacts the inner side of the limiting side plate 14, the electric push rod 33 is started to move the cutting plate 34 downwards, the canvas is pressed by the upper pressure plate 310, the cutting blade 39 is located at the end of the cutting grooves 11 at the moment, the small motor 321 is started to drive the cutting blade 39 to perform translational cutting, the small motor 321 is rotated reversely to return the cutting blade to the original position after the cutting is completed, and the cut canvas is taken down.
